What Are Horizontal Roller Impact Windows?
Horizontal roller impact windows are a type of sliding window where one or more panels move horizontally rather than opening vertically. What sets them apart from ordinary sliding units is the laminated safety glazing built into each unit. This material consists of two panes of tempered or annealed glass held together by a durable interlayer — most commonly polyvinyl butyral (PVB) — that holds fragments in place on impact.
The frame itself is a key part of the system. STS Impact Windows & Doors works with horizontal roller impact windows constructed with reinforced vinyl frames that resist corrosion year after year. The roller hardware is built to remain smooth even through decades of opening and closing. Multi-point locking hardware keep the window locked against the frame when not in use.
At the structural level, these windows function using low-friction roller bearings mounted at the lower edge of the frame. Effortless lateral movement means no warping over time. When closed and locked, the window's weatherstripping create a tight barrier against hurricane-force gusts — exactly the level of protection Florida's building code mandate.
Benefits of Horizontal Roller Impact Windows
- Hurricane-Force Wind Resistance: Horizontal roller impact windows are built to survive wind speeds exceeding 150 mph, securing your property intact during a storm.
- No Shutters Required: Because the impact glazing is always in place, there's no reason to install hurricane panels before a storm.
- Lower Utility Bills: The insulated glazing limits solar heat gain, trimming AC demand in South Florida's intense summer heat.
- Quieter Living Spaces: The PVB laminate that resists wind also muffles outside noise, leaving your home noticeably quieter.
- UV Protection: Horizontal roller impact windows screen up to nearly all UV light, protecting your belongings from sun damage.
- No Swing Clearance Needed: Because the glazing unit rolls along the track, there's nothing swinging into a walkway, which makes this style perfect for covered walkways and entryways.
- Stronger Locking Systems: Multi-point locking mechanisms working alongside impact-rated glass make horizontal roller impact windows much more difficult to force open than standard windows.
- Lower Homeowner's Insurance: Many property owners in the area qualify for meaningful discounts on homeowner's insurance when they invest in approved impact products.

Do horizontal roller impact windows help me get homeowner's insurance savings in Florida?
Absolutely, for most policyholders. Florida law mandates insurers to recognize mitigation improvements to homeowners who upgrade to approved hurricane protection products. Horizontal roller impact windows that carry Miami-Dade Notice of Acceptance (NOA) or Florida Product Approval usually meet the criteria for these credits.
